– Introduction: Understanding the Importance of Sleep

Sleep is a crucial aspect of our lives. It is important for both physical and mental health, yet many people still take it for granted. Unfortunately, the busyness of daily life often causes us to sacrifice sleep, leading to negative consequences.

Getting enough sleep is necessary for our bodies to function properly. It is during this time that our body repairs and regenerates itself. Lack of sleep can lead to decreased immune function, making us more susceptible to illness. It can also affect our metabolism, making it more difficult to maintain a healthy weight.

Not getting enough sleep can also impact our mental health. We may experience increased levels of stress, anxiety, and depression. It can also affect our cognitive function, leading to difficulties with memory and decision-making.

Overall, it is crucial to prioritize sleep for both our physical and mental well-being. Making sleep a priority can lead to improved health, increased productivity, and a better quality of life.

– The Science of Sleep: Explore Different Sleep Stages and How They Affect Your Health

Understanding the different sleep stages can be vital in ensuring that you get the right amount of sleep for your body to function optimally. There are four stages of sleep that your body goes through in a cycle that lasts for approximately 90-120 minutes. The four sleep stages are N1, N2, N3, and REM sleep, and they each have different characteristics.

N1 sleep is the initial stage of sleep when you start to drift off and is the lightest stage of sleep. It generally lasts for 5-10 minutes and is characterized by a relaxed state with slower breathing and a slowed pulse rate.

N2 sleep is the second stage of sleep and lasts for approximately 20 minutes. During this stage, your eyes are still, and your body temperature decreases. It is also a light sleep stage but key for the integration of information you’ve learned during the day.

N3 sleep is when you start to go into a deep sleep and is also known as slow-wave sleep. During this stage, the body repairs itself and tissues are regenerated. It is typically harder to awaken someone during this stage of sleep, and it can last up to 40 minutes.

REM (Rapid Eye Movement) sleep is the most complex stage of sleep. It is when dreaming occurs and is characterized by rapid eye movements. It is also when your brain consolidates memories and processes emotions. REM sleep typically occurs 90 minutes after falling asleep and lasts for approximately 20-25 minutes, and the cycle can start all over again.

In conclusion, understanding the different sleep stages and how they affect your health and wellbeing can help you better understand how much sleep you need for your body to function properly. Developing good sleep habits is essential for your physical and mental health, so make sure you prioritize it!

– Essential Health Tips for Better Sleep: Hygiene Practices and Lifestyle Changes

The importance of quality sleep cannot be overemphasized, and it is a crucial part of a healthy lifestyle. Not getting enough sleep can lead to various health problems, including obesity, diabetes, and depression. Making hygiene practices and lifestyle changes can enhance the quality of your sleep. Here are some health tips for better sleep.

Maintain a Consistent Sleep Schedule
Maintain a regular sleep schedule, even on weekends. Aim for at least seven to eight hours of sleep every night. Train your body to sleep and wake up at the same time every day. Consistency builds a routine that can improve the quality of your sleep.

Keep Your Room Comfortable
A comfortable and peaceful area can have a significant impact on your sleep. Invest in a comfortable mattress, pillows, and sheets. Keep your room temperature between 60 and 67 degrees Fahrenheit for optimal sleep conditions. You could also reduce noise levels in your room with earplugs or a white noise machine.

Limit Caffeine and Alcohol Consumption
Caffeine and alcohol affect your sleep negatively, so it is best to limit or avoid their consumption altogether. Caffeinated drinks should be avoided at least six hours before bedtime. Similarly, while alcohol might make you feel drowsy, it will negatively affect your sleep cycle and make you feel restless.

By adopting these simple steps, you can have better sleep and improve your overall health significantly. Remember, good sleep is essential for your mental and physical wellbeing.

– How to Create a Bedroom Environment That Encourages Restful Sleep

Choosing the right color scheme
The color of your bedroom walls can have a significant impact on your sleep quality. Stick with colors that promote a calming atmosphere and avoid bright, bold colors. Colors like light blue, lavender, and soft gray can help create a calm and peaceful environment while red, orange, and bright yellow can stimulate the mind and prevent a restful night’s sleep.

Create a comfortable bed
Invest in high-quality sheets, pillows, and a comfortable mattress to create a sleep-conducive environment. Opt for soft, breathable fabrics like cotton or linen for maximum comfort. Your mattress should be comfortable enough to support your body in its natural alignment, and your pillows should be soft and supportive for your head and neck.

Minimize noise and light disruptions
Unwanted noise and light can disrupt your sleep and prevent you from getting a restful night’s sleep. Consider installing blackout curtains or shades to block out any light disturbances. Additionally, white noise machines or earplugs can help minimize noise disruptions and improve the quality of your sleep.

Keep your bedroom cool
Your bedroom environment plays a crucial role in maintaining a restful sleep. Keeping your bedroom cool can help regulate your body temperature and promote sleep. In general, the ideal bedroom temperature should be between 60-67°F (15-19°C). Consider using a fan or air conditioning to regulate the temperature and ensure optimal sleeping conditions.

– Common Sleep Disorders and When to Seek Professional Help

Insomnia:

Not being able to fall asleep or stay asleep is known as insomnia. This is the most common sleep disorder among adults. Individuals with insomnia find it difficult to focus during the day due to tiredness. This can lead to lowered cognitive function, irritability, and depression. Insomnia can be caused by a variety of factors, including stress, anxiety, medication, or an underlying medical condition such as sleep apnea. If you are unable to get enough sleep because of insomnia, it is advisable to seek professional help.

Sleep Apnea:

Sleep apnea is a sleep disorder in which an individual’s breathing temporarily stops during sleep. Sleep apnea can cause loud snoring, restless sleep, and headaches on waking up. It can also lead to other health problems like high blood pressure, heart diseases, and even stroke. Obstructive sleep apnea is the most common form of sleep apnea, affecting more than 20 million Americans. If you or someone you know is experiencing sleep apnea symptoms, it is important to consult a healthcare professional as proper treatment can improve the quality of life.

Narcolepsy:

Narcolepsy is a neurological disorder that affects the brain’s ability to control sleep-wake cycles. Narcolepsy can cause sudden episodes of muscle weakness, vivid dreaming, or falling asleep at inappropriate times throughout the day. This can interfere with daily activities and even trigger accidents. Narcolepsy symptoms can be treated with medications, and patients can undergo counseling to learn coping strategies. If you think you have narcolepsy, it is important to seek medical assistance.

Restless Leg Syndrome:

Restless leg syndrome (RLS) is a disorder that causes an irresistible urge to move the legs. RLS can also cause uncomfortable sensations in the legs that can disrupt sleep. This sleep disorder can be caused by an underlying medical condition or genetic factors. RLS symptoms can be treated with medications and lifestyle changes. Those experiencing symptoms of RLS should discuss with a healthcare professional.

In conclusion, seeking help from a professional is crucial if you are experiencing any symptoms of sleep disorders. A healthcare professional can diagnose and help treat the underlying causes of the sleep disorder that can improve your overall health and quality of life.
